On March 18, 1961, the Tupolev Tu-28 (Tu-128) interceptor made its first flight. The Soviet aircraft became the largest and heaviest fighter ever produced.
On March 16, 1916, the U.S. Army's 1st Aero Squadron flew its first military mission over foreign territory during the Punitive Expedition against Pancho Villa in Mexico.
